Как сделать новую вкладку в Excel: все способы с пояснениями

Работа с несколькими листами в Microsoft Excel — основа эффективного структурирования данных. Новые вкладки позволяют разделять информацию по темам, периодам или проектам, избегая хаоса в одном файле. Однако многие пользователи до сих пор создают копии файлов вместо того, чтобы добавлять листы — это не только неудобно, но и чревато ошибками при синхронизации данных.

В этой статье мы разберём все актуальные способы создания вкладок в современных версиях Excel (2019–2026), включая малоизвестные приёмы для ускорения работы. Особое внимание уделим отличиям между Windows и macOS, а также раскроем нюансы работы с Excel Online и мобильными приложениями. Вы узнаете не только как добавить лист, но и как правильно его назвать, переместить или скрыть — всё для профессиональной организации рабочей книги.

1. Стандартный способ: кнопка «+» внизу экрана

Самый очевидный и универсальный метод — использование специальной кнопки в интерфейсе программы. Она расположена справа от существующих вкладок и выглядит как значок плюса («+») на зелёном фоне. Этот способ работает во всех версиях Excel, включая веб-версию и мобильные приложения.

Чтобы добавить новую вкладку:

  1. Откройте файл Excel или создайте новый (Ctrl+N).
  2. Обратите внимание на нижнюю часть окна, где отображаются названия листов (Лист1, Лист2 и т.д.).
  3. Нажмите на значок «+» справа от последней вкладки.

Новый лист появится справа от активного и получит название по умолчанию (Лист4, Лист5 и т.д.). В Excel 2026 при создании листа автоматически активируется режим редактирования его названия — это удобно для быстрого переименования.

2. Горячие клавиши: быстрее мыши в 3 раза

Для опытных пользователей клавиатурные комбинации экономят десятки часов в год. В Excel есть два варианта горячих клавиш для добавления листов:

  • 🔹 Shift + F11 — универсальная комбинация, работает во всех версиях Excel на Windows и macOS. Новый лист появится слева от активного.
  • 🔹 Alt + Shift + F1 — альтернативный вариант, но в новых версиях Excel (2021+) может конфликтовать с другими функциями.

Преимущество этого метода — скорость и возможность добавления листов без отрыва рук от клавиатуры. Например, если вы вводите данные в таблицу и понимаете, что нужна новая вкладка для дополнительных расчётов, достаточно нажать Shift+F11, и лист будет создан мгновенно.

📊 Каким способом вы чаще добавляете листы в Excel?
Кнопкой «+» внизу
Горячими клавишами
Через меню «Вставка»
Не знаю, как это делать

3. Через меню «Вставка»: когда нужно больше контроля

Если вам требуется не просто добавить лист, а вставить его в конкретное место (например, между двумя существующими вкладками), удобнее использовать меню Вставка. Этот способ также полезен, если вы работаете на ноутбуке без цифрового блока клавиш, где комбинация Shift+F11 может не сработать.

Инструкция:

  1. Выделите вкладку, перед которой хотите вставить новый лист (кликните по её названию левой кнопкой мыши).
  2. Перейдите в меню Главная → Ячейки → Вставить → Вставить лист.
  3. Либо используйте контекстное меню: кликните правой кнопкой по названию вкладки и выберите Вставить.

Новый лист появится слева от выделенной вкладки. Этот метод особенно удобен, если вам нужно добавить несколько листов подряд в определённом порядке.

Почему новый лист вставляется слева, а не справа?

В Excel исторически сложилась логика, что новые элементы (строки, столбцы, листы) добавляются перед выделенным объектом. Это связано с тем, что пользователи чаще вставляют данные в начало структуры, а не в конец. Например, при добавлении строки в таблицу новая строка появляется выше выделенной, чтобы не сбивать существующие данные.

4. Создание листа на основе шаблона

Если вам нужно добавить не пустой лист, а вкладку с заранее подготовленной структурой (например, с шапкой таблицы, формулами или условным форматированием), можно использовать шаблоны. Это сэкономит время на рутинных действиях.

Как это сделать:

  1. Создайте лист с нужной структурой (например, ежемесячный отчёт с формулами).
  2. Кликните правой кнопкой по названию вкладки и выберите Переместить/Скопировать.
  3. В открывшемся окне установите флажок Создать копию и выберите место для нового листа (например, в конец).
  4. Нажмите ОК — появится копия листа с тем же содержимым, но с названием Лист1 (2).

Этот метод незаменим для регулярных отчётов, где структура таблиц повторяется. Например, если вы ежемесячно формируете сводки по продажам, достаточно один раз создать шаблон, а затем копировать его.

Способ добавления Горячие клавиши Преимущества Недостатки
Кнопка «+» Простота, работает везде Лист добавляется только в конец
Shift + F11 Shift + F11 Мгновенное создание Лист вставляется слева от активного
Меню «Вставка» Контроль над позицией листа Требует больше действий
Копирование шаблона Сохраняет структуру и формулы Нужно заранее подготовить шаблон

5. Особенности работы в Excel Online и на Mac

Пользователи Excel Online (веб-версия) и macOS сталкиваются с нюансами, которых нет в классическом Excel для Windows. Разберём ключевые отличия:

  • 🍎 На Mac:
    • Комбинация Shift + F11 работает, но может конфликтовать с системными сочетаниями клавиш.
    • Чтобы добавить лист через меню, используйте Вставка → Лист (вместо Ячейки → Вставить как в Windows).
    • Контекстное меню вкладок открывается по Control + клик (а не правой кнопкой мыши).
  • 🌐 В Excel Online:
    • Кнопка «+» для добавления листа расположена справа внизу, но может быть скрыта при узком окне браузера.
    • Горячие клавиши Shift+F11 не работают — используйте только кнопку или меню Главная → Вставить → Лист.
    • Невозможно перемещать листы перетаскиванием (только через меню Главная → Формат → Переместить/скопировать лист).

Если вы часто работаете в Excel Online, рекомендуем закрепить вкладку браузера с файлом — это ускорит доступ к кнопке добавления листов и снизит риск потери данных при обрыве соединения.

6. Автоматизация: создание листов через VBA

Для продвинутых пользователей, которые хотят автоматизировать рутинные задачи, подойдёт создание листов с помощью макросов VBA. Например, можно написать скрипт, который будет добавлять новый лист с текущей датой в названии или копировать шаблон по клику.

Пример кода для добавления листа с названием «Отчёт_ДДММГГГГ»:

Sub AddReportSheet()

Dim ws As Worksheet

Set ws = Worksheets.Add(After:=Worksheets(Worksheets.Count))

ws.Name = "Отчёт_" & Format(Date, "DDMMGGGG")

End Sub

Чтобы использовать этот код:

  1. Нажмите Alt + F11, чтобы открыть редактор VBA.
  2. Вставьте код в модуль (меню Insert → Module).
  3. Закройте редактор и назначьте макрос на кнопку или сочетание клавиш (Alt + F8 → выберите макрос → Назначить).

Убедитесь, что вкладка «Разработчик» включена (Файл → Параметры → Настройка ленты)

Сохраните файл в формате .xlsm (с поддержкой макросов)

Отключите блокировку макросов в параметрах безопасности (если файл из доверенного источника)

Создайте резервную копию книги перед запуском нового макроса-->

Автоматизация особенно полезна для ежедневных отчётов, где требуется создавать десятки листов с одинаковой структурой. Например, в бухгалтерии или логистике.

7. Частые ошибки и как их избежать

Даже в такой простой операции, как добавление листа, пользователи допускают ошибки, которые ведут к потере данных или сбоям в работе файла. Разберём типичные проблемы:

⚠️ Внимание: Если в книге уже есть 255 листов (максимум для Excel), кнопка «+» станет неактивной. Чтобы добавить новый лист, придётся удалить или скрыть один из существующих.
  • 🚫 Лист не добавляется:
    • Проверьте, не защищена ли структура книги (меню Рецензирование → Защитить книгу).
    • Убедитесь, что файл не открыт в режиме Только для чтения.
  • 🔄 Лист создаётся не там, где нужно:
    • Перед добавлением выделяйте вкладку, перед которой должен появиться новый лист.
    • Используйте меню Переместить/скопировать, чтобы изменить порядок листов после создания.
  • 📛 Проблемы с именем листа:
    • Excel не позволяет использовать в названиях символы: / \ * ? : [ ].
    • Максимальная длина названия — 31 символ.
    • Нельзя создавать листы с одинаковыми именами (даже если они отличаются регистром).
⚠️ Внимание: Если вы работаете в Excel для Android/iOS, некоторые функции (например, VBA или перемещение листов) могут быть ограничены. Перед редактированием сложных файлов проверьте совместимость на сайте поддержки Microsoft.

FAQ: Ответы на частые вопросы

Можно ли добавить лист в Excel, если файл открыт в режиме совмещённого редактирования?

Да, но с оговорками. В Excel Online и Excel 365 при совместной работе новые листы будут видны всем пользователям сразу. Однако если кто-то уже редактирует структуру книги (например, перемещает листы), ваши изменения могут не сохраниться. Рекомендуем согласовывать такие действия с коллегами.

Как вернуть случайно удалённый лист?

Если вы удалили лист и не сохранили файл, воспользуйтесь функцией Отменить (Ctrl+Z). Если книга была сохранена после удаления, попробуйте:

  1. Закрыть файл без сохранения и открыть его заново (есть шанс, что Excel восстановит предыдущую версию).
  2. Проверьте Файл → Сведения → Управление книгой → Восстановить несохранённую книгу (работает не во всех версиях).
  3. Используйте резервные копии, если они включены (Файл → Открыть → Последние → Восстановить несохранённые книги).

В будущем настройте автосохранение (Файл → Параметры → Сохранение) с интервалом 5–10 минут.

Почему в моём Excel нет кнопки «+» для добавления листа?

Это может происходить по нескольким причинам:

  • 🔍 Панель вкладок свёрнута — наведите курсор на нижнюю границу окна и потяните её вверх.
  • 🔒 Книга защищена от изменений (проверьте в меню Рецензирование).
  • 🖥️ Вы используете Excel Starter или урезанную версию (например, в некоторых корпоративных сборках).
  • 🌐 В Excel Online кнопка может быть скрыта при узком окне браузера — разверните его на весь экран.
Как сделать, чтобы новые листы добавлялись с конкретным названием по умолчанию?

По умолчанию Excel присваивает листам имена Лист1, Лист2 и т.д. Чтобы изменить это поведение, потребуется макрос VBA. Например, этот код будет присваивать новым листам название «Данные_» + порядковый номер:

Private Sub Workbook_NewSheet(ByVal Sh As Object)

Dim i As Integer

i = Worksheets.Count

Sh.Name = "Данные_" & i

End Sub

Чтобы активировать его:

  1. Откройте редактор VBA (Alt+F11).
  2. Дважды кликните по объекту ThisWorkbook в дереве проекта.
  3. Вставьте код и сохраните файл как .xlsm.

Теперь все новые листы будут создаваться с заданным шаблоном имени.

Можно ли добавить лист в Excel с помощью формулы?

Нет, в Excel нет формул, которые могли бы добавлять или удалять листы. Для этого требуется:

  • 🖱️ Ручные действия (кнопка, меню, горячие клавиши).
  • 🤖 Макрос VBA (как описано в разделе про автоматизацию).
  • 📱 Office Scripts (в Excel Online для корпоративных пользователей).

Формулы в Excel предназначены для вычислений и анализа данных, но не для изменения структуры книги.